Murshidabad Violence: Trinamool Congress leader Kunal Ghosh has made a massive accusation in connection with the Murshidabad violence that killed three people, alleging that a central agency and the Border Security Force were part of the “conspiracy”.
Ghosh alleged that the BSF facilitated the entry of miscreants through the border and gave them “safe passage to return” after the violence.
His allegations drew a sharp retort from the BJP, which accused the ruling TMC of giving a clean chit to those involved in arson and violence in the name of protests against the recently enacted Waqf Amendment Act.
TMC’s Big Allegation Against BSF
“There were some bad incidents in Murshidabad. We made appeal to the common people. Don’t respond to any provocation from the BJP because the guardian of West Bengal, CM Mamata Banerjee, is here. You do not worry,” Ghosh said.
The TMC leader claimed that there was a “larger conspiracy” behind the violent incidents that raised tensions in Murshidabad.

“We are receiving some inputs and allegations that there was a larger conspiracy behind those incidents. Some section of Central agency, a section of BSF and a section of two-three other political parties, they were involved in this conspiracy and with the help of a part of BSF, there was a gap in border and some miscreants entered, they made chaos and they were given safe passage to return,” he alleged.
Ghosh claimed that most visuals shared by the BJP from the violence belong to other states and different incidents. He alleged that the saffron party is attempting to “provoke” the people of the state.
BJP Hits Back At TMC
Leader of Opposition in the State Assembly Suvendu Adhikari reacted sharply to the remarks and equated the TMC with Bangladesh militant group Ansarullah Bangla Team. Dubbing the TMC an “anti-national and jihadi-controlled party”, he demanded an NIA investigation into the Murshidabad violence.
BJP’s national spokesperson Shehzad Poonawalla lashed out at Ghosh and Congress leader Digvijaya Singh for their remarks on the violence.
“After Kunal Ghosh who blamed BSF for Bengal Waqf Violence now Digvijaya Singh blames RSS.. implying Hindus are only responsible even though it’s Hindus who are receiving end of Jihadi violence. This is the true face of Congress,” he said.

Citing Calcutta High Court’s observation that it “cannot turn a blind eye” to the situation in Murshidabad, the BJP leader said that Kunal Ghosh and Digvijaya Singh were insulting the central forces.
The police have said that the situation in Murshidabad is returning to normal.
Three people had died in the violent protests against the Waqf Act last week, prompting the Calcutta High Court to order the deployment of central forces in the tense regions.
Over 150 people were arrested in connection with the violence, in which the police officials also sustained injuries.
